Vue的elementUI实现自定义主题方法
狼蚁网站SEO优化长沙网络推广团队倾力分享:Vue的ElementUI自定义主题方法详解
今天我们将与大家分享一种通过Vue框架实现ElementUI组件库自定义主题的方法。ElementUI是一套为开发者、设计师和产品经理准备的基于Vue的高质量UI组件库。它的灵活性和丰富的样式使得开发者可以轻松地构建出美观的界面。对于追求个性化设计的开发者来说,自定义主题无疑是一个很好的选择。下面,我们将详细介绍如何为ElementUI定制个性化的主题。
我们需要明确的是,ElementUI的样式是基于Sass进行开发的,因此我们需要安装Sass相关的工具。在项目的根目录下,我们可以使用npm或yarn安装Sass和sass-loader。安装完成后,我们就可以开始自定义主题了。
接下来,我们需要在项目的src目录下创建一个新的Sass文件,用于覆盖ElementUI的默认样式。我们可以根据ElementUI提供的Sass变量覆盖默认的样式值,以实现个性化的主题设计。我们还可以引入ElementUI的Sass文件,并使用Sass的特性进行样式的覆盖和扩展。通过这种方式,我们可以轻松地为ElementUI组件定制个性化的样式。
为了更方便地管理和维护自定义的样式文件,我们可以使用Vue CLI的插件系统来自动化构建和打包样式文件。通过这种方式,我们可以确保样式文件的更新与项目的构建过程同步进行。我们还可以利用浏览器的缓存机制来优化样式的加载速度,提高页面的性能。
为了更好地推广我们的自定义主题,我们可以将主题样式文件上传至GitHub或其他代码托管平台,与其他开发者共享我们的设计成果。通过这种方式,我们可以为ElementUI社区贡献自己的力量,同时也能从其他开发者的作品中汲取灵感,共同进步。
通过以上的步骤和方法,我们可以轻松地实现ElementUI的自定义主题设计。希望我们的分享能够对大家有所帮助,为开发更加美观、个性化的Vue项目提供有益的参考。让我们一起在Vue和ElementUI的世界里更多的可能性吧!跟随长沙网络推广的步伐,让我们一起深入了解如何在Vue项目中使用elementUI并自定义主题,以满足项目的特定需求。这篇文章将带你逐步了解两种方法来实现自定义主题,让你的elementUI组件与项目风格完美融合。
我们先来了解一下第一种方法——使用命令行主题工具。
一、安装主题工具和相关依赖
你需要先安装element-theme和chalk主题。可以通过npm进行安装,具体命令如下:
```bash
npm i element-theme -g
npm i element-theme-chalk -D 从 npm 安装
或
npm i -D 从 GitHub 拉取代码
```
二、初始化变量文件
使用命令 `et -i` 初始化变量文件,你可以在此时自定义变量文件的名称。执行此命令后,会在根目录下生成一个element-variables.scss文件,其中定义了许多颜色变量。
三、修改变量并编译主题
你可以直接编辑element-variables.scss文件,修改其中的颜色变量为你所需要的颜色。修改完成后,使用命令 `et` 编译主题。
四、引入自定义主题
将编译好的主题文件引入项目,并在入口文件main.js中引入。然后,在项目中的样式文件中,你就可以看到主题色的改变了。
接下来,我们了解第二种方法——直接修改element样式变量。
一、安装vue-cli并创建新项目
使用vue-cli创建基于webpack的新项目,并在项目中安装elementUI以及sass-loader和node-sass。
二、改变element样式变量
在src下建立element-variables.scss文件,并写入对应的代码来改变element的样式变量。然后,在入口文件main.js中引入这个文件即可。
这样,你就成功实现了elementUI的自定义主题。默认的颜色已经变为你自定义的了,如果有其他的改变,只需在element-variable.scss文件中改变相应的变量即可。
以上就是长沙网络推广分享的Vue的elementUI实现自定义主题的方法。希望这篇文章能够对你有所帮助,也希望大家能够支持狼蚁SEO。如果你有任何问题或需要进一步的帮助,请随时联系我们。让我们一起学习,一起进步!在浩瀚的宇宙间,有一颗星球格外引人注目,它就是我们赖以生存的世界。此刻,让我们一起领略其独特的魅力,深入其千变万化的面貌。我们将以生动的笔触,带你领略这个世界的精彩纷呈。
在这美好的世界中,每一个地方都有其独特的风景和故事。无论是山川湖海,还是森林草原,每一处都充满了生机与活力。在这里,你可以感受到大自然的呼吸,领略到生命的韵律。从涓涓细流到滔滔江水,从蜿蜒的山脉到深邃的海洋,世界以它独特的方式展示着自己的魅力。
走进森林,你可以听到鸟儿的歌唱,看到动物的嬉戏。在这里,万物共生,和谐共处。森林中的每一棵树,每一片叶子,都在诉说着生命的故事。它们经历了岁月的洗礼,见证了历史的变迁,却依然顽强地生长,为世界带来生机与活力。
来到城市,你可以感受到人类的智慧与创造力。高楼大厦拔地而起,桥梁隧道贯穿大地。人们在创造美好生活的也在不断地未知领域,追求更高的境界。城市的繁华与乡村的宁静相互映衬,共同构成了一幅美丽的画卷。
世界还是文化的熔炉。不同的民族、不同的国家,都有着自己独特的文化传统和风俗习惯。这些文化元素共同构成了世界的丰富多彩。在这里,你可以领略到各种各样的艺术形式,如音乐、舞蹈、绘画等。这些艺术形式是文化的载体,它们传递着人类的精神和情感,让世界变得更加美好。
这个世界充满了奇迹和惊喜。让我们怀着的心情,去感受这个世界的精彩纷呈。让我们用心去体验、去发现、去珍惜每一个美好的瞬间。在这个美好的世界中,我们共同创造属于我们的故事。
seo排名培训
- Vue的elementUI实现自定义主题方法
- 常见JS验证脚本汇总
- JS实现控制文本框的内容
- js实现匹配时换色的输入提示特效代码
- JavaScript生成图形验证码
- 微信小程序 开发经验整理
- 对于Laravel 5.5核心架构的深入理解
- php实现支付宝当面付(扫码支付)功能
- Angularjs中的$apply及优化使用详解
- phpmailer绑定邮箱的实现方法
- SQLServer 镜像功能完全实现
- mysql基础知识扫盲
- VUE 自定义组件模板的方法详解
- Laravel 5.1 on SAE环境开发教程【附项目demo源码】
- JavaScript常用基础知识强化学习
- 编写PHP脚本来实现WordPress中评论分页的功能